THE WEATHER.

SUMMARY AND FORECAST.

Present indications are for mild, ajid hazy conditions, with fair to cloudy weather, decreasing eoutherlles, hacking by west to Increasing' northerlles, In about 24 hjurs, when the barometer will probably. fall everywhere. An Antarotio depression has passed southward of Now Zooland, causing hlKh westerly winds and stormy weather, especially about Fovoanz Strait, but fair, to oloudy weather has prevailed In tho north. The barometer has been very • unstoady In tho south, but remained high In tho northern districts. D. 0. BATES. ; Meteorological Office, Wellington, March, 3, '1913. DISTRICT REPORTS. (From Our Special Correspondents.) Foildinrr, March 3.—Fine, warm day; calm night. ( Shannon, March 3.—After a rough Sunday, the weather is now line and warm. Otaki, February 3— Brlcht sunshine. Featherstori, Jtaroh 3.—Bright lino day. Greytown, March i.—K Uno summer's day, Masterton, March 3.—Another warm but oloudy day. Hastings, March 3.—To-day has' been fine; mild temperature. .
